Rollup merge of rust-lang#134740 - Flakebi:amdgpu-target, r=workingju…
…bilee Add amdgpu target Add amdgpu target to rustc and enable the LLVM target. Fix compiling `core` with the amdgpu: The amdgpu backend makes heavy use of different address spaces. This leads to situations, where a pointer in one addrspace needs to be casted to a pointer in a different addrspace. `bitcast` is invalid for this case, `addrspacecast` needs to be used. Fix compilation failures that created bitcasts for such cases by creating pointer casts (which creates an `addrspacecast` under the hood) instead. MCP: rust-lang/compiler-team#823 Tracking issue: rust-lang#135024 Kinda related to the original amdgpu tracking issue rust-lang#51575 (though that one has been closed for a while).

# `amdgcn-amd-amdhsa` | ||
|
||
**Tier: 3** | ||
|
||
AMD GPU target for compute/HSA (Heterogeneous System Architecture). | ||
|
||
## Target maintainers | ||
|
||
- [@Flakebi](https://github.com/Flakebi) | ||
|
||
## Requirements | ||
|
||
AMD GPUs can be targeted via cross-compilation. | ||
Supported GPUs depend on the LLVM version that is used by Rust. | ||
In general, most GPUs starting from gfx7 (Sea Islands/CI) are supported as compilation targets, though older GPUs are not supported by the latest host runtime. | ||
Details about supported GPUs can be found in [LLVM’s documentation] and [ROCm documentation]. | ||
|
||
Binaries can be loaded by [HIP] or by the HSA runtime implemented in [ROCR-Runtime]. | ||
The format of binaries is a linked ELF. | ||
|
||
Binaries must be built with no-std. | ||
They can use `core` and `alloc` (`alloc` only if an allocator is supplied). | ||
At least one function needs to use the `"gpu-kernel"` calling convention and should be marked with `no_mangle` for simplicity. | ||
Functions using the `"gpu-kernel"` calling convention are kernel entrypoints and can be used from the host runtime. | ||

## Building Rust programs | ||
|
||
The amdgpu target supports many hardware generations, which need different binaries. | ||
The generations are exposed as different target-cpus in the backend. | ||
As there are many, Rust does not ship pre-compiled libraries for this target. | ||
Therefore, you have to build your own copy of `core` by using `cargo -Zbuild-std=core` or similar. | ||
|
||
To build a binary, create a no-std library: | ||
```rust,ignore (platform-specific) | ||
// src/lib.rs | ||
#![feature(abi_gpu_kernel)] | ||
#![no_std] | ||
#[panic_handler] | ||
fn panic(_: &core::panic::PanicInfo) -> ! { | ||
loop {} | ||
} | ||
#[no_mangle] | ||
pub extern "gpu-kernel" fn kernel(/* Arguments */) { | ||
// Code | ||
} | ||
``` | ||
|
||
Build the library as `cdylib`: | ||
```toml | ||
# Cargo.toml | ||
[lib] | ||
crate-type = ["cdylib"] | ||
|
||
[profile.dev] | ||
lto = true # LTO must be explicitly enabled for now | ||
[profile.release] | ||
lto = true | ||
``` | ||
|
||
The target-cpu must be from the list [supported by LLVM] (or printed with `rustc --target amdgcn-amd-amdhsa --print target-cpus`). | ||
The GPU version on the current system can be found e.g. with [`rocminfo`]. | ||
|
||
Example `.cargo/config.toml` file to set the target and GPU generation: | ||
```toml | ||
# .cargo/config.toml | ||
[build] | ||
target = "amdgcn-amd-amdhsa" | ||
rustflags = ["-Ctarget-cpu=gfx1100"] | ||
|
||
[unstable] | ||
build-std = ["core"] # Optional: "alloc" | ||
``` | ||
|
||
## Running Rust programs | ||
|
||
To run a binary on an AMD GPU, a host runtime is needed. | ||
On Linux and Windows, [HIP] can be used to load and run binaries. | ||
Example code on how to load a compiled binary and run it is available in [ROCm examples]. | ||
|
||
On Linux, binaries can also run through the HSA runtime as implemented in [ROCR-Runtime]. | ||
